Glad you got to play it.  Each character has a mini-story, and when you beat all of them you'll see a conclusion.  The game saves your scores for each character and when you play microgames seperately.  When you replay a character's folder, after you beat the boss you'll keep going with harder levels.  There's a surprising amount of replay value to be had.  Especially with all the extras you can unlock.
